Underground Boston: Old North Church & Unearthing the North End
The Old North Church was featured on WCVB’s recent airing of Underground Boston. Take a behind the scenes tour of the historical landmark and learn more about some of the precious artifacts found in the North End, read more on WCVB.

Director of Nursing Appointed for North End Rehabilitation & Healthcare Center
Beth Fearon has been appointed the Director of Nursing at the North End Rehabilitation and Healthcare Center. Fearnon oversees the nursing department at the 100-bed skilled nursing center, continue reading.
